Blockchain es una tecnología de contabilidad digital descentralizada y distribuida que se utiliza para registrar transacciones en múltiples computadoras de una manera que garantiza la seguridad, transparencia e integridad de los datos. A continuación se ofrece una descripción detallada de los aspectos clave de la tecnología blockchain:

### Características clave de Blockchain:

1. **Descentralización**:

- A diferencia de las bases de datos centralizadas tradicionales administradas por una sola entidad, una cadena de bloques se mantiene mediante una red de nodos (computadoras). Cada nodo tiene una copia de toda la cadena de bloques, lo que garantiza que no exista ningún punto único de falla.

2. **Transparencia**:

- Todas las transacciones registradas en blockchain son visibles para todos los participantes de la red. Esta transparencia mejora la confianza, ya que todas las transacciones se pueden verificar de forma independiente.

3. **Inmutabilidad**:

- Una vez que los datos se registran en un bloque y se agregan a la cadena de bloques, no se pueden modificar ni eliminar. Esta inmutabilidad se logra mediante hash criptográfico y garantiza la integridad de los datos.

4. **Seguridad**:

- Blockchain utiliza técnicas criptográficas para proteger transacciones y datos. Cada bloque contiene un hash criptográfico del bloque anterior, una marca de tiempo y datos de la transacción. Este encadenamiento de bloques hace que sea extremadamente difícil alterar cualquier información sin alterar todos los bloques posteriores, lo que requeriría el consenso de la mayoría de la red.

5. **Mecanismos de consenso**:

- Las redes Blockchain utilizan algoritmos de consenso para acordar la validez de las transacciones. Los mecanismos de consenso comunes incluyen Prueba de trabajo (PoW), Prueba de participación (PoS) y varios otros. Estos mecanismos garantizan que todos los nodos de la red estén de acuerdo con el estado actual de la cadena de bloques.

### Cómo funciona Blockchain:

1. **Inicio de transacción**:

- Una transacción se inicia cuando un usuario solicita transferir activos o información. Esta transacción se transmite a la red.

2. **Validación**:

- Los nodos de la red validan la transacción utilizando reglas de consenso predefinidas. Por ejemplo, en Bitcoin, los mineros resuelven complejos acertijos matemáticos para validar transacciones (PoW).

.

en